Pierre Fabre is the 2nd largest dermo-cosmetics laboratory in the world, the 2nd largest private French pharmaceutical group and the market leader in France for products sold over the counter in pharmacies.
Its portfolio includes several medical franchises and international brands including Pierre Fabre Oncologie, Pierre Fabre Dermatologie, Eau Thermale Avène, Klorane, Ducray, René Furterer, A-Derma, Naturactive, Pierre Fabre Oral Care.
Established in the Occitanie region since its creation, and manufacturing over 95% of its products in France, the Group employs some 10,000 people worldwide. Its products are distributed in about 130 countries. 86% of the Pierre Fabre Group is held by the Pierre Fabre Foundation, a government-recognized public-interest foundation, while a smaller share is owned by its employees via an employee stock ownership plan.
In 2019, Ecocert Environment assessed the Group’s corporate social and environmental responsibility approach in accordance with the ISO 26000 sustainable development standard and awarded it the “Excellence” level.

Nous recrutons en CDI à Gien (45) ou à Castres (81) un(e) Acheteur(se) CAPEX Equipements & bâtiments/travaux.
Au sein de l’équipe Achats CAPEX & Maintenance, sous la responsabilité du Directeur Achats Matières Premières et CAPEX , vous assurez l’optimisation des achats de CAPEX (Equipements & bâtiments/travaux) et de services de Maintenance, en matière de coût, de délais, et de qualité, tout en respectant les normes pharmaceutiques et dermo-cosmétiques.
Vous développez l’innovation et gérez les risques ainsi que la performance RSE des fournisseurs et équipements/prestations. Vous êtes également impliqués dans la conduite de projets complexes, de la négociation en approche coût total de possession (TCO) et sur le cycle de vie complet des équipements, incluant les coûts de maintenance. Vous assurez un reporting régulier sur les projets et les dépenses CAPEX, incluant des rapports financiers détaillés, et établissez des relations efficaces avec les interlocuteurs internes majeurs et les responsables techniques ou projet pour garantir une collaboration fluide et productive.
